The Award Contest for “Milorad Macura” and “Dimitrije Perišić”

The 2021 Award Contest of the Institute of Architecture and Urbanism of Serbia for the best master’s theses and doctoral dissertations in the field of architecture and urbanism and spatial planning is open for entries.

The Institute of Architecture and Urbanism of Serbia traditionally awards annual prizes for the best master’s theses and doctoral dissertations defended at the faculties of universities in Serbia with departments or chairs in the field of architecture, urbanism and spatial planning, as follows:

• Annual Award “Milorad Macura” for the best master’s thesis in the field of architecture and urbanism;

Annual Award “Milorad Macura” for the best doctoral dissertation in the field of architecture and urbanism;

• Annual Award “Dimitrije Perišić” for the best master’s thesis in the field of spatial planning;

• Annual Award “Dimitrije Perišić” for the best doctoral dissertation in the field of spatial planning.

Conditions:

• Awards are given for the best master’s theses and doctoral dissertations defended in the previous school year (2020/2021), i.e. in the current year until December 15, 2021, for the proposals submitted in accordance with the contest announcement;

• Proposals for awards are submitted in writing or electronically to the Secretariat of the Institute, within 75 days from the date of the competition, or from September 30 to December 15 of the current year (address: Bulevar kralja Aleksandra 73 / II, e-mail: iaus@iaus.ac.rs, institut.iaus@gmail.com, with the note: For the Institute’s Award);

• The right to nominate a work for the award has the dean of the faculty, the head of the department, the head of the chair, the committee for selection of works, and the mentor of the work;

• The proposal for the award shall contain a letter from the proposer with the following: proposer’s details, candidate’s details (name and surname, study area, work title, short biography, address and telephone number), mentor’s details, short presentation/explanation paper, a copy of the master’s thesis or doctoral dissertation (obligatory in electronic form, and preferably in printed form, which shall be returned to the proposer).

The decisions on awards shall be made by January 15, 2022, with a written explanation of the Commission of the Institute and published on the website of the Institute and in an advertisement in the media. The awards will be presented at the ceremony on the occasion of Saint Sava’s Day, on January 27, at the Institute.

The annual awards consist of a plaque, a set of publications, and a review of the awarded work in the “Architecture and Urbanism”, a national journal of international importance published by the Institute. Annual awards also may consist of prize money in accordance with the financial capabilities of the Institute, the amount of which is determined by the Board of Directors of the Institute on the proposal of the Director.
